NBA Free Agency has started with LeBron James. LeBron James became the first player to hit the open market in 2010 NBA free agency.
On Thursday, NBA free agency has opened with LeBron James. After a month of predictions, LeBron James grabbed the chance of opening the market in 2010. All the teams have started their picks and delivers at 12:01 am where some of the teams are very eager to pick some key players.
LeBron James became the hot topic on the first day of NBA free agency. Currently, he is playing for Cleveland Cavaliers. But, there is lot of rumors that LeBron James will leave the Cleveland Cavaliers. Atlanta Journal-Constitution and New York Knicks reported that the Hawks are willing to pay the maximum salary deal for the All-Star shooting guard.
Situations became tense on Thursday, when the New Jersey Nets and Knicks are planned to visit Ohio in order to discuss with LeBron James. However, LeBron James is not only the high reputation player but there are many players who will become free agents in 2010. Some of them are Dwyane Wade, Chris Bosh, Amare Stoudemire, Paul Pierce, Ray Allen, Tyson Chandler, Richard Jefferson, Joe Johnson, Tracy McGrady, Yao Ming, Dirk Nowitzki and Michael Redd.
